A good personal trainer should be able to work with anyone of any physical or personality type. All personal trainers should know that they don't have to train or prepare their students for bodybuilding or kickboxing competitions, have to lead them on a path to health, and be role models for them. It should be considered that a professional personal trainer must have a certification. These certifications can certify that s/he is qualified.

All of this can be helpful, but it's more important for a personal trainer to know what exercises he or she is teaching the students during their workouts. Along with the knowledge and having a certified certificate such as a coaching card, etc., the experience that a personal trainer can get at work is vital to his/her business.


The types of people a personal trainer may encounter during his/her career:

-People with injuries and other special conditions
-People who cancel their class with a brief reminder or without notice.
-People who continuously get excuses that they can't keep practicing
-People who constantly complain about why they don't lose weight despite these exercises. If it is necessary, suggest them consulting a nutritionist.
-People who are not satisfied with the practices that a personal trainer gives them

Every person is different, and a personal trainer has to keep in mind that it is complicated to impress and attract different people with different beliefs. A good personal trainer should be able to give the client what he or she needs. S/he also needs to be very flexible and be prepared to recognize the strengths and weaknesses of his/her workouts and their students and change them immediately if they are inappropriate and ineffective.
Personal trainers should keep up-to-date on their job for guaranteeing and maintaining the credibility of their certificate. They also should keep themselves up-to-date on all fitness training such as EMS Training to help their students achieve their goals sooner. The federation usually offers seminars and courses on updating and promoting degrees. Still, there are other ways to find information and the most up-to-date articles on the subject, such as translating sports articles, reading sports-science books, and more.

The benefits of being a personal trainer:
1. Working with people is individual to individual: In other words, each of your clients has a specific day and time for practicing with you, with a greater focus on training sessions.

2. Gaining Positive Feedback and Bonus: Nothing is better than the moment your students finally see or feel the changes in their bodies.

3. Job flexibility: You can set the hour and day of training as you wish, or set your salary if you work independently.

4. Once you find the right job and place in this business, you will gain more experience from your work. Depending on the community you practice, you will touch their needs during these sessions. These may include preparing them to join a sport, training with seniors to restore balance and particular stability, or helping those looking for losing weight.
Whatever you are interested in, it is best to have your expertise now and to create your style as a professional personal trainer. It is a natural process that, as the community under your supervision expands your knowledge in your field should increase.
